Imitation Accelerated Q-learning on a Simulated Formula Student Driverless Racecar
2020
Master's thesis in Information- and communication technology (IKT590) In the international Formula Student competition, only a handful compete in the driverless category. Most of them using expensive hardware such as LIDAR’s. By leveraging reinforcement learning, a cheaper camera based system can be created .In order to train this system a simulator based on a fork of Microsoft’s AirSim by Formula Technion was used. A virtual replica of a Formula Student car designed for 2020 by Align Racing UiA, functioned as the test vehicle. A Supervised Attention-Based Multiclass Classifier for Tile Discarding in Japanese Mahjong
2021
Master's thesis in Information- and communication technology (IKT590) Japanese Mahjong, an imperfect-information, multiplayer, multi-round game, has become an area of interest for the AI community due to its immense imperfect-information space and complex playing and scoring rules. In 2020 Microsoft unveiled the Mahjong AI Suphx that managed to outdo most of the top human players in Tenhou.net, the most popular platform for Japanese Mahjong. With supervised learning, Suphx’s discard model reached a prediction accuracy of 76.7% when tested on game logs from Tenhou.net.
